We can now report that the Christmas Luncheon on December 22 was attended by 167 and was an outstanding affair. Neil Roberts '35 presided, and Norrie Williamson '26 introduced the undergraduate speakers, Martin H. Shore '56, Monte D. Pascoe '57, Joseph B. Blake '58 and Paul K. Clarkin '59, all of whom gave excellent talks. The cocktail party arranged by Bob Fullerton '51 for later on in the same day was well attended by Dartmouth men and their wives, many of whom stayed on for dinner to renew old acquaintances.
On January 25, the Dartmouth Alumni Association of the Great Divide holds its 61st Annual Meeting and dinner, and it is most fitting that we honor President Dickey on this occasion.
"A terrific party" is the announcement of Ralph Rickenbaugh '28 for Monday, April 2, when the Dartmouth Glee Club will give its concert at Phipps Auditorium at 8:30 p.m. This will be followed by a dance, and Rick's committee, consisting of Richard Catron '50, Neil Roberts '35, Norris Williamson '26, Donald McKinlay '37 and Hart Gilchrist '31, are hard at work to make this Glee Club concert and dance the best ever.
